Scenario Description
The Northwest Soviet Front under Colonel-General Kuznetsov fell back on Barbarossatag (the first day of Unternehmen Barbarossa) before the onslaught of Army Group North under von Leeb. The Germans interpreted this as a general retreat, but Kutznesov was planning a counter-attack. Elements of the Soviet III and XII Mechanized Corps crashed into the XLI Panzer Corps near Raseiniai. The battle lasted four days and resulted in the destruction of the Northwest Front's armor and in Kuznetsov's dismissal. A huge gap opened between the Soviet 8th and 11th armies, and the road to Leningrad was now open to Army Group North.

Battle Narrative
The Battle of Raseiniai was a large tank battle that took place in the early stages of Operation Barbarossa, the German invasion of the Soviet Union. The battle was fought between the elements of the German 4th Panzer Group and the Soviet 3rd Mechanized Corps with the 12th Mechanized Corps, in Lithuania, 75 km (47 mi) north-west of Kaunas. The Red Army tried to contain and destroy the German troops that had crossed the Neman River but was unable to prevent them from advancing.
